Subject: [PATCH 0/8] mediatek: final preparation for OF_UPSTREAM support
Date: Mon, 27 Jan 2025 14:40:37 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250127134046.26345-1-ansuelsmth@gmail.com> (raw)

This is the last batch of part to push actual support of
OF_UPSTREAM for the mediatek SoC.

The plan is to make the current downstream DTS on part with
upstream implementation so we can permit a gradual transition to
it while we don't cause any regression to any user.

This is to have the same node downstream and upstream.
Mediatek is working hard upstream to also push all the remaining
nodes.

All patch are the final changes after the pinctrl patch
merged previously.

All patch pass CI tests tested in this PR [0]

[0] https://github.com/u-boot/u-boot/pull/731

Christian Marangi (7):
  pinctrl: mediatek: mt7981: rename reg-names to upstream linux format
  pinctrl: mediatek: mt7986: rename reg-names to upstream linux format
  mediatek: mt7986: move gpio-controller up and rename pinctrl to pio
  pinctrl: mediatek: mt7988: rename reg-names to upstream linux format
  mediatek: mt7988: move gpio-controller up and rename pinctrl to pio
  mediatek: mt7981: move gpio-controller up and rename pinctrl to pio
  arm: dts: mediatek: add PCIe node for MT7981

John Crispin (1):
  arm: dts: mediatek: add USB nodes for MT7981
